Output 4153911b75215abb737739cc00e07ea986c6378c22991cd7611527d825eaeb10:23

value
18989434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07956d9bd58af6b12f4307646578ac95625e55f1 OP_EQUAL
address
M8bFyDv9N1AGyHwVedck8RQdVf7oUYiq4j
transaction
4153911b75215abb737739cc00e07ea986c6378c22991cd7611527d825eaeb10
spent
true